Dating back to ancient civilizations, plumbing has evolved significantly over time. The Roman Empire, for instance, had a highly advanced water supply and sanitation system consisting of aqueducts, sewers, and public baths. Today, plumbing encompasses a broad range of areas, including residential, commercial, and industrial sectors. It involves the installation, repair, and maintenance of pipes, fixtures, valves, fittings, and drainage systems.
Plumbing is intricately connected to our daily lives; it ensures that we have access to clean water for drinking, cooking, and cleaning. Moreover, it plays a vital role in preventing the spread of diseases by efficiently disposing of wastewater. The Role of Plumbing in Commercial Buildings
In commercial buildings such as offices, retail spaces, and hotels, plumbing systems are significantly more complex compared to residential setups. These systems need to handle higher volumes of water usage and accommodate multiple fixtures simultaneously. They include features such as backflow prevention devices, water storage tanks, and irrigation systems. Properly designed and maintained plumbing systems are crucial for businesses to provide adequate facilities for their employees and customers.
